Cool, great, awesome.
Argentina's word for cool. Describes plans, things, and especially people — "un tipo re copado" is a genuinely good guy. Often stacked with "re" for emphasis.
Mexico says chido, Colombia says bacano, Chile says bacán, Spain says guay.
